Report: Freshman Texas A&M DL Ondario Robinson arrested for theft

Heading into the bye this weekend, the Texas A&M Aggies will have to deal with some bad news, as it was reported that a player was arrested for theft on Monday.
According to SportsDay.DallasNews.com, freshman DL Ondario Robinson now faces a misdemeanor theft charge after his Monday arrest.
Robinson hasn’t played at all this season, but the former 3-star recruit was an important part of the Aggies’ 2017 recruiting class.
Robinson’s charge is for theft of an item between $100 and $750, but it is unclear what he allegedly stole at this time.
Coach Kevin Sumlin has yet to comment on the arrest, and it remains to be seen when he’ll do so as the Aggies enter their bye week.
UPDATE: Apparently, Robinson was caught taking a “bait bike” planted by the Texas A&M university police department:
I obtained the probable cause statement: Robinson was arrested on charges of taking a "bait bike" on campus owned by UPD. It's worth $350.
